After graduating from university for college, you should started to think about the loans you needed to get through these years. The loans should pay back in a timely manner in order to keep a good credit rating for such times when you may need another loan to buy a house or car.
For some students who have a few student loans to repay concurrently, it can be a financial drain on their family finances. That is where student loan consolidation comes in.
Consolidating student loans basically consolidates all your student loans into one loan so that it is easier to manage and make payments. When you are obtaining a student loan consolidation whether from the government or the private market, your existing student loans are paid for and erased by the student loan consolidation company. The balances are transferred to the new student loan consolidation. Thus you start a new loan and only needs to make a single payment each month.
There are many advantages to consolidating your student loans. The interest rates will be lower since it takes the average interest rates of your previous student loans. The government legislation, the maximum interest rate is limited under 8.25 percent.
It becomes a lot easier to manage a single student loan and payment is easier. The repayment plan are quite flexible. For federal student loan consolidation, you can opt to start repaying after you have graduated from school. There are also several other options.
